Facilities Ticket — Cleaning Crew Access, Brindle Annex

For new starters handling evening lock-up: the Sorano Cleaning crew arrives nightly at 21:30 via the annex side door. Check their rota sheet, note arrival in the log, and ensure the storeroom is relocked afterward. To let them through the side door, enter the access code below.

badge for yaweg-hafog: bdg-GX-6

**Q3 Planning Note — Logistics Transition**

Board: we are terminating the Kelbrook Freight arrangement at quarter end. Varnholt Carriers takes over all regional routes from October. Transition costs are within the approved envelope; warehouse handover at Dunmore is the only flagged risk. Service-level penalties in the new contract are materially stronger. Staff communications go out after signature, not before. No customer-facing changes expected in the first sixty days. The confidential summary of related business plans follows below.

internal memo for kawip-hadug: Headcount on the Wenwyn team goes from 7 to 140 by the end of January. Gross margin on Wenwyn came in at 20 percent against a plan of 15 percent.

Handing off the Quillbus broker upgrade (4.x to 5.1) to Dario. Cluster is half-migrated; mixed-version mode is supported but TLS cert rotation must finish before cutover. No auth model changes, though the admin API gained two new endpoints worth reviewing. Open questions and the migration checklist are tracked on the internal page below.

dashboard of taduf-bawef = https://jira.lumicsys.internal/projects/display/browse/b1cbf89d

## FAQ: Why are my plugin's alerts merged?

Squelchr deduplicates on fingerprint, not title. If your plugin emits identical fingerprints for distinct incidents, they collapse. Set a unique `dedupe_key` per incident source. Custom hash strategies require registration in the plugin manifest. Undocumented strategies are rejected at load time. For fingerprint registration questions, write to the plugin desk.

alerts address for kajog-tadup: druox@plorvanet.internal

**Wiki: Break-Glass Access — Fernmap Offline Mode**

If a field crew is stuck offline and their Fernmap sync token expires mid-survey, on-call can grant break-glass access without the auth service. Don't do this casually — it bypasses audit hooks until the next sync. Open the admin panel, pick "offline override," and when prompted, enter the recovery passphrase printed directly below.

recovery phrase for bawif-hahif: ralael-tamdor